Why Knowing Your Exact Aquarium Gallonage Matters
Many enthusiasts depend on the small size printed on the tank's packaging-- such as a "55-gallon" or "20-gallon long." Nevertheless, these numbers are typically rounded approximations. Additionally, they represent the overall volume of glass, not the actual volume of water.

Standard Aquarium Shapes and Formulas
A lot of aquariums are geometric shapes. By taking a couple of basic measurements (length, width, and height) in inches, one can easily calculate the volume in cubic inches and transform it to gallons.
The Golden Rule of Conversion:1 cubic foot = 7.48052 gallons.Additionally, for measurements in inches: ₤ text Volume in Gallons = frac text Length times text Width times text Height 231 ₤ (given that 1 gallon includes 231 cubic inches).

Requirement Aquarium Size Reference Table
To save time, aquarists can reference the basic glass aquarium sizes listed below. Remember that glass thickness and rim designs imply real water volume is typically about 10% lower than the nominal score.
Tank Rating (Gallons)Approximate Dimensions (L x W x H in inches)Estimated Actual Water Volume5 Gallon16 x 8 x 10~ 4.5 Gallons10 Gallon20 x 10 x 12~ 8.5 Gallons20 Gallon High24 x 12 x 16~ 18 Gallons20 Gallon Long30 x 12 x 12~ 18.5 Gallons29 Gallon30 x 12 x 18~ 25 Gallons40 Gallon Breeder36 x 18 x 16~ 37 Gallons55 Gallon48 x 13 x 21~ 50 Gallons75 Gallon48 x 18 x 21~ 68 Gallons90 Gallon48 x 18 x 24~ 78 Gallons125 Gallon72 x 18 x 22~ 112 GallonsAccounting for Displacement: The Hidden Factor
Computing the physical measurements of the glass box only informs half the story. Once an aquarium is decorated, hardscape materials and equipment displace a substantial quantity of water. If an aquarist medicates a "55-gallon" tank that in fact only holds 45 gallons of water due to heavy decor, they risk a dangerous overdose.
